WooCommerce measurement price calculator
,

Complete Guide: Add a Measurement Price Calculator to WooCommerce

by

— May 14, 2024

If you sell variable or customizable products, it makes sense to use a WooCommerce measurement price calculator to determine what to charge customers.

Customers can input their exact requirements and the calculator will show the final product price based on what the customer entered.

In this detailed guide, we’ll show you how to add a custom price calculator to your site using the powerful WooCommerce Product Options plugin.

WooCommerce measurement price calculator

The best part? It takes less than 10 minutes to set it up from start to finish. Let’s get started.

What is a measurement price calculator in WooCommerce?

A measurement price calculator is a tool that allows customers to buy products based on specific measurements — such as length, width, or volume — rather than a fixed quantity. It’s particularly useful for WooCommerce stores that sell customizable or variable products. Think: fabrics, carpets, or liquids sold by volume.

measurement price calculator

For example, let’s say you run an online store that sells custom-sized tiles. With a measurement price calculator, customers can input the dimensions of their floors, such as length and width, and the calculator will automatically determine the final product price based on these measurements.

This tool simplifies the purchasing process for both the customer and the store admins. It gives customers the flexibility to order precisely what they need and ensures they get the right amount of product without overbuying or underbuying. And since it’s all automated, store admins don’t have to manually calculate prices for each customer.

Popular use cases for WooCommerce measurement price calculators

Products that are best sold using a measurement price calculator typically involve customizable or variable dimensions.

Here are some common examples:

  1. Custom furniture: Stores that offer customized furniture pieces like countertops, tabletops, or shelves may benefit from measurement price calculators. Customers can input dimensions and select materials to get accurate pricing for their orders. 
  2. Custom furnishing: Companies that sell custom blinds or curtains use measurement price calculators to enable customers to enter window dimensions and select fabric options. This ensures customers get the right size and material for their windows.
  3. Custom fabrics: Businesses that sell fabrics by the yard or meter often use measurement price calculators to allow shoppers to specify the exact length of fabric they need for their project, whether it’s for sewing clothes, curtains, or upholstery.
  4. Flooring materials: Stores that offer carpets, tiles, laminate, and other flooring materials often use measurement price calculators to allow customers to input the dimensions of their rooms or areas to calculate the precise amount of material needed for installation.
  5. Liquids sold by volume: Businesses that sell liquids like paint, oil, or cleaning solutions typically use measurement price calculators to enable customers to input the desired volume they need. The calculator will determine the corresponding price based on the selected product.

Introducing the best WooCommerce measurement price calculator plugin 

WooCommerce Product Options is a powerful plugin that lets you add custom calculators with both simple and complex price formulas to your online store’s product detail pages.

It’s super easy to use on the backend. And you can configure the calculator with operators for addition, subtraction, division, multiplication, brackets, etc. in minutes. Plus, it has built-in conditional logic to control how the price calculator functions on the front end of your site.

custom price calculator woocommerce

If customers update the content in the input fields, the plugin automatically updates the total price on the individual product page as well as the cart and checkout pages. This ensures that customers are always charged the correct amount.

WooCommerce Product Options plays nice with all Iconic plugins. For instance, you can use it with WooCommerce Attribute Swatches to showcase color and image variation swatches for products. Also, you can pair it with Flux Checkout for WooCommerce to add a conversion-optimized, distraction-free multi-step checkout to your store.

Flux Checkout for WooCommerce

Flux Checkout transforms the default WooCommerce checkout into one that’s lightning-fast, distraction-free, and reduces checkout abandonment.

A quick note: WooCommerce Product Options is a comprehensive product options plugin. This means it allows you to add checkboxes, image swatches, date pickers, dropdown menus, and more, to your product detail pages, in addition to the measurement price calculator. Check here for its complete feature list.

How to create a WooCommerce measurement price calculator

Adding the custom price calculator to your WooCommerce site is pretty straightforward. Follow these steps.

1. Create a new product options group or edit an existing one

  1. Get WooCommerce Product Options and add the plugin to your site. You’ll need to enter a license key to activate it.
  2. In your site’s admin, go to Products > Product Options.
woocommerce product options
  1. When you install the plugin on your site, it adds a product options group by default. Press Add Group or hover over the default group to edit or delete it.
  2. Give the product options group a name. Tick the Display checkbox if you want this to be visible on the product page. Otherwise, leave it blank.
edit product option group
  1. The Visibility options let you decide which product detail pages to add the custom price calculator to. You can choose to:
    • Showcase it storewide on all product pages.
    • Showcase it only on particular products or product categories.
    • Exclude the custom calculator from product detail pages of specific products or categories.

2. Add input boxes

  1. Press Add Option.
add number field
  1. Give the option a name and choose the Number field to create an input box. You can create input boxes for shoppers to enter the dimensions related to the product they want to purchase, such as length, width, weight, quantity, etc.
create input box
  1. Enter the name in the label field under the choice section, for example, “Length (cm)”.
  2. Select No cost in the Price Type field. You’ll enter the formula at a later step in the Price Formula field.
  3. Optional: Enter a short description for this input box.
  4. Tick the Required checkbox to force customers to add the necessary values to the price calculator.
  5. Press Save changes to save the input field.
  6. Repeat the steps to add the required Number fields to capture other dimensions of the product, such as depth or width.

3. Add the formula for the WooCommerce measurement price calculator

  1. Press Add Option.
measurement price formula
  1. Give the option a name and pick the Price formula field. The price formula field will input the values from the Number fields you created earlier and apply the custom formula you’ll set up in the next step to calculate the total product price for each customer.
  2. Now, enter the custom formula to calculate the price. Use the values from the Number field you created earlier together with the relevant operators — addition, subtraction, multiplication, and division. Feel free to select the appropriate buttons underneath the formula field.
  3. Add custom text to be shown next to the price on the product detail pages in the Price display suffix field. Continuing with the curtain example from above, you can add something apt like “Per centimeter” as the suffix.
  4. Tick the Ignore main product price if you wish to prevent the main product price from being added to the formula’s calculated price.
  5. Save the settings.

4. Optional: Advanced settings and extra product options

WooCommere Product Options lets you add more advanced options like number limits, conditional logic, and extra product option fields to each product.

Add conditional logic to the WooCommerce measurement price calculator

Let’s say you sell standard curtain sizes in addition to custom-sized versions. You can decide to hide the price calculator on the product detail page by default. 

This avoids cluttering up the page for customers who want standard-sized curtains. Customers who want custom-sized curtains can select an option to reveal the price calculator fields and enter custom dimensions for their order.

Here’s how to add conditional logic to each measurement price calculator:

  1. Access the Edit page for the price calculator.
conditional logic measurement price cal
  1. Select Advanced settings to reveal the conditional logic options.
  2. Configure the options.
  3. Save the settings once done.

Add extra product options in addition to the WooCommerce measurement price calculator

You can add additional product options like text labels, text input fields, checkboxes, dropdown menus, radio buttons, file uploads, date pickers, clickable image buttons, etc., together with the price calculator to product detail pages.

You can even set fixed prices for the additional product options. Customers who select them will be charged the extra rates on top of the total price from the price calculator.

Here’s how to add extra product options to each measurement price calculator:

  1. Press the Add Option button.
extra product options
  1. Give the option a name and pick the appropriate field type.
  2. Add as many choices as required and set prices: a flat rate, quantity-based, a percentage increase, or a percentage decrease.
  3. Save the settings once done.

5. Publish and test your measurement price calculator

Once you’ve saved the product options group you created, it should appear as an option group in Product > Product Options.

To make sure everything works as expected, head to your site’s front end and take the price calculator for a spin before real customers begin to use it. Enter a couple of test values to confirm that the total product price it calculates is accurate.

Ready to create your WooCommerce measurement price calculator?

Adding a custom calculator to your site is a no-brainer if you sell products that need to be customized or products with a lot of variations.

WooCommerce Product Options is the best WooCommerce measurement price calculator plugin. It makes it super easy to add custom calculators with basic and advanced price formulas to your site’s product pages.

You can customize the calculators with operators for subtraction, addition, multiplication, division, and brackets, and add advanced settings like number limits and conditional logic.

Get started with WooCommerce Product Options and create custom measurement price calculators today!

Katie is CEO and founder of Barn2 Plugins. A high profile figure in the WordPress community, she loves teaching website owners how to get the most out of their sites.

Katie’s story has been told in numerous WordPress and tech industry publications. As well as speaking at WordCamp conferences, her passion for sharing her knowledge and experience has also led her to co-host two podcasts – WP Product Talk and Woo BizChat at Do the Woo – where she discusses a wide range of topics related to selling WordPress products and WooCommerce extensions.